Instant Pot Creamy Ranch Chicken

This Instant Pot Creamy Ranch Chicken is a rich, comforting, and easy weeknight dinner with tender chicken in a zesty, creamy ranch sauce.

Servings: 4 servings

Ingredients

  • 2 pounds chicken breasts boneless and skinless, fresh or frozen
  • 1 ounce ranch seasoning mix 1 oz envelope
  • 1 cup water
  • 8 ounces cream cheese
  • 4 ounces diced green chiles mild, 1 small can
  • 10 ounces cream of chicken soup condensed, undiluted, 1 small can
  • 2 cups chicken broth low sodium
  • 8 ounces egg noodles

Instructions

  • If using frozen chicken breasts, no need to thaw! Just place them directly into the Instant Pot. If using fresh, lay the chicken breasts at the bottom in a single layer.
  • Sprinkle the ranch seasoning mix evenly over the chicken. Pour in the water and low sodium chicken broth to create a flavorful base.
  • Tear the cream cheese into chunks and distribute it over the chicken. Add the diced green chiles and the cream of chicken soup. Do not stir; let ingredients sit on top.
  • Seal the Instant Pot lid and set to cook on high pressure for 15 minutes (20 minutes if using frozen chicken). Ensure pressure release valve is set to sealing.
  • Once cooking is complete, perform a quick release of pressure by turning the valve to venting. Be cautious of the steam.
  • Open the lid and shred the chicken with two forks directly in the pot. The chicken should be tender and easy to pull apart.
  • Add the egg noodles directly into the pot with the shredded chicken and creamy sauce. Stir to combine. Lock the lid and cook on high pressure for 4 minutes. Perform a quick release again.
  • Stir everything well to combine noodles with the creamy ranch sauce. Serve hot, garnished with fresh herbs if desired.

Notes

  • Use frozen chicken breasts to save time; just increase cooking time to 20 minutes.
  • Cut cream cheese into small pieces for even melting and creaminess.
  •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days and reheat with a splash of broth if needed.
  • Try swapping chicken for turkey or tofu for dietary variations.
  • Use gluten-free pasta or zucchini noodles for a lighter, gluten-free option.
